MPCA MEAL Toolkit Launch (Option 1)

Join Save the Children International for the launch of the USAID - Bureau for Humanitarian Assistance-funded Multi-Purpose Cash Assistance (MPCA) MEAL Toolkit (available in Arabic, English, French, and Spanish), which was developed in partnership with the International Rescue Committee and Mercy Corps with inputs from over 26 other organizations. This webinar will introduce the toolkit and how it can be used to measure MPCA programs. This multi-agency toolkit includes tools and XLSForm/KoBo survey templates (PDM, market monitoring, and baseline-endline survey) to facilitate the implementation of MPCA programs.

Sharpening our Tools: Refining Approaches to Capacity Strengthening Design and Measurement

In this webinar, USAID Advancing Nutrition will contextualize capacity-strengthening design and measurement tools through several examples of locally-led nutrition work in Nigeria. Speakers will share their experience in strategically designing multi-faceted and layered capacity-strengthening programs and strategies for addressing measurement challenges. In addition, this webinar will feature insights on measuring several levels of capacity strengthening in Nigeria, including a leadership development program delivered through the African Nutrition Leadership Program and systems strengthening for the State Committees on Food and Nutrition (SCFNs), state-level coordinating bodies for nutrition. This webinar will be available in English and French.

Elevating Climate Change Adaptation and Mitigation in USAID’s Agricultural, Nutrition, and Food System Programming to Inform Strategy Implementation

The Board for International Food and Agricultural Development (BIFAD), an advisory committee to the U.S. Agency for International Development (USAID) on food and agricultural development issues, is hosting a full-day public meeting, Elevating Climate Change Adaptation and Mitigation in USAID’s Agricultural, Nutrition, and Food System Programming to Inform Strategy Implementation: A Discussion of the BIFAD Climate Change Subcommittee Draft Commissioned Report, to address the opportunities and challenges of transformational climate change adaptation and mitigation in USAID’s agricultural, nutrition, and food systems programming. SLAM Meeting: Building and Sustaining a Learning Culture

Join us for the second Strategic Learning & Adaptive Management (SLAM) Meeting on October 10 focused on building and sustaining a learning culture! A learning culture is an environment in a project or organization where individuals and teams are supported in being able to continuously learn and improve their work without the fear of repercussions if results and outcomes are not achieved as expected. A strong learning culture facilitates the process of adaptive management and contributes to improved programming.
